In Table 2, we provide the results of generalized linear model (GLM) 27 analyses in which we compare the presence of anxiety or mood disorders with the presence or absence of ADHD. The ASD (+) ADHD group had an increased risk of reported anxiety disorder (adjusted relative risk 2.20; 95% confidence interval [CI] 1.97–2.46) and mood disorder (adjusted relative risk 2.72; 95% CI 2.28–3.24) compared with the ASD (?) ADHD group. Increasing age was the most significant contributor for both anxiety disorder and mood disorder (both P < .001), and the absence of report of ID was a significant contributor for mood disorder only (P < .001). Given the association between increasing age and parent-reported ADHD, we also analyzed relative risks by age subgroups (school-aged and adolescent) to better appreciate a clinical practice perspective. As expected, we found an increased prevalence of both anxiety disorder and mood disorder in the adolescent group compared with the school-aged group for both the ASD (+) ADHD and ASD (?) ADHD groups; however, there were higher relative risk ratios for the school-aged group compared with the adolescent group for both anxiety disorder and mood disorder. Within the age subgroups, we also found the same pattern as in the full data set that increasing age was the most significant contributor to the presence of both anxiety and mood disorders (for both age groups and both conditions: P < .001), and absence of report of ID was a significant contributor for mood disorder only (school-aged: P = .041; adolescent: P = .001).
